Risks of Revenue Cycle Management India for Revenue Cycle Leaders
Revenue cycle leaders considering delivery from India are usually trying to solve a real capacity problem: rising transaction volume, persistent AR backlogs, payer follow up demands, coding support needs, and difficulty hiring experienced staff at the required scale. The risks of revenue cycle management India models do not come from geography alone. They come from weak ownership, inconsistent training, uncontrolled access, poor handoffs, limited production visibility, and contracts that measure staffing rather than revenue outcomes. A strong model treats India based delivery as part of the operating system, with the same governance expected from internal teams.
The Main Risk Is Fragmented Accountability
When work is distributed across onshore and India based teams, responsibility can become unclear. One group may collect payer information, another may update the billing system, and a third may decide whether to appeal, correct, or write off an account. If service levels measure only completed tasks, leaders may not see whether the work moved the claim toward resolution or simply transferred it to another queue.
For an RCM leader, this creates aging inventory with many touches but little progress. For a CFO, it weakens confidence in cash forecasts and revenue reporting. For a CIO or compliance leader, it creates access, audit, and support risk when people use multiple systems without consistent role definitions, credential controls, or evidence of who changed what.
Operational Risks Revenue Leaders Should Evaluate
- Training inconsistency: Staff may know the billing system but lack specialty, payer, or client specific workflow knowledge.
- Handoff delay: Questions wait for the next shift or move through email instead of a visible exception queue.
- Quality measured too late: Errors are found after claim rejection, denial, appeal failure, or payment posting discrepancy.
- Access sprawl: Users receive broader system or portal access than their duties require.
- Attrition and knowledge loss: Process knowledge stays with individuals rather than documented playbooks and controlled workflows.
- Volume over outcome: Productivity metrics reward account touches even when root causes remain unresolved.
- Business continuity gaps: Connectivity, staffing, credential, or system incidents do not have tested fallback procedures.
- Vendor dependency: The provider organization cannot see queue logic, quality findings, staffing changes, or automation failures in enough detail.
A typical scenario involves an AR team checking payer portals overnight, updating claim notes, and sending unresolved cases to an onshore escalation mailbox. If the escalation categories are vague, the onshore team spends the next day reopening records, asking for missing details, and deciding who owns the issue. The offshore team appears productive, but the claims continue aging because the handoff design does not support resolution.
Why Data Security and Access Control Must Be Operational Controls
Healthcare revenue work uses patient, insurance, claim, remittance, and financial information. Leaders should therefore treat access as part of workflow design rather than a one time IT approval. Each role should have the minimum required access, named business ownership, controlled credentials, documented onboarding and removal, monitored activity, and a clear process for temporary or elevated access.
The control also needs to cover payer portals, shared drives, spreadsheets, screen captures, downloaded reports, and support tools. A secure billing platform does not protect data that is copied into uncontrolled work files. Auditability improves when work is completed through governed queues, standard reason codes, and system records instead of informal messages and local trackers.
Where RPA Can Reduce Risk and Where It Can Add Risk
RPA can reduce dependence on repetitive manual work by checking claim status, collecting payer responses, validating account fields, updating worklists, preparing denial packages, matching remittance records, and routing exceptions. It can also create consistent timestamps and reason codes, which improves visibility across time zones. These benefits are valuable when the automation is built around stable rules and tested against real payer and system conditions.
RPA can add risk when ownership is unclear. Credentials may expire, payer portals may change, screen layouts may move, source files may arrive late, or business rules may be updated without notifying the support team. A bot that fails silently can create a larger backlog than a manual team because leaders may assume the work is complete. Production alerts, run logs, exception thresholds, fallback procedures, and change testing are therefore essential.
A Governance Checklist for India Based RCM Delivery
- Define outcomes: Measure claim movement, exception age, denial prevention, payment accuracy, and AR resolution, not only transactions completed.
- Document ownership: Name the business owner, delivery owner, quality owner, IT owner, and escalation owner for each workflow.
- Standardize exceptions: Use precise reason codes and require evidence for unresolved cases.
- Control access: Apply role based access, credential management, user review, and prompt removal when responsibilities change.
- Review quality early: Detect registration, coding, claim, and payment defects before they create downstream revenue loss.
- Design continuity: Test backup staffing, system outage procedures, portal failure procedures, and communication paths.
- Govern automation: Monitor bot runs, changes, exceptions, credentials, and manual fallback work.
- Maintain transparency: Require shared dashboards, queue level reporting, recurring operations reviews, and root cause improvement plans.

How to Select and Operate the Right Delivery Model
Leaders should compare three models: task based outsourcing, dedicated team delivery, and outcome focused managed operations. Task based work can be suitable for stable, narrow activities, but it often leaves cross functional exceptions with the provider. Dedicated teams offer knowledge continuity but require strong governance. Outcome focused operations can improve accountability when the scope, data, service levels, quality rules, and decision rights are defined clearly.
A phased approach is safer than moving an entire function at once. Start with a controlled workflow, establish baseline quality and aging, document exceptions, test security and continuity, and run parallel validation. Expand only when reporting shows that the new model improves resolution rather than moving work between queues. Revenue leaders should retain visibility into process rules, performance data, and the right to adjust ownership as conditions change.
